Broncos Secure Victory in Sloppy Showdown Against Raiders

In a matchup that showcased more defensive prowess than offensive flair, the Denver Broncos emerged victorious over the Las Vegas Raiders on Thursday night. The game, marked by missed opportunities and turnovers, was a testament to the strength of Denver's defense, which effectively stifled quarterback Geno Smith and the Raiders' offensive efforts.

From the outset, the Broncos' defensive unit dominated the field, applying relentless pressure and forcing critical mistakes. Smith struggled to find rhythm, resulting in a series of stalled drives that left the Raiders unable to capitalize on scoring chances. The Broncos, while not flawless themselves, managed to convert enough plays to secure a narrow win.

This victory adds to the Broncos' strong start to the season, raising hopes among fans for a potential playoff run. As the season progresses, the team will look to build on this defensive foundation while seeking improvements on the offensive side of the ball.
